【文章內(nèi)容簡介】 time D. less tune 四、閱讀理解 (每小題 2分,滿分 20分 ) A Li Shihen was born in 1518. His father was a poor doctor. Li Shizhen often saw that people fell ill. He decided to study medicine so that he could be able to help people. Li Shizhen read many books about medicine. He found many of the old medical books to be full of mistakes. So his wish was to write a new one. He did his best to study medical science. He studied not only the herbs (革藥 ) in his own garden, but also the wild ones. He set out many times on long journeys to collect herbs and talk with old peasants. He learned a lot from the working people. After many years of hard work and study, Li Shizhen finished his great work Ben Cao Gang Mu (本草綱目 ) . At that time he was sixty. His book is now one of the greatest contributions (貢獻 ) of the Chinese people to the medical science of the world. ( ) 41.
